A470 near Builth Wells reopens after two-vehicle crash
The A470 near Builth Wells in Powys has reopened after a two-vehicle collision caused long queues.
The incident happened on Friday between the B4594 at Erwood and A483 Station Road, Builth Wells, according to Traffic Wales.
The road was closed for a short time in both directions as emergency services were called to the scene.
It is not yet known whether anyone was hurt.
